The INSIGHT and PARASOFT environment variables


Versions of Insure++ earlier than 2.1 required that an environment variable called INSIGHT be set to the Insure installation directory. Beginning with version 2.1, Insure only requires that the bin.$ARCH directory be on your path.

Versions of Insure++ starting with 3.1 added the PARASOFT environment variable. The only difference between the two variables is that INSIGHT is used only by Insure++, while PARASOFT is used by all ParaSoft tools. They both perform the same function.

If you find it useful to set either variable, remember that it will be used by Insure++, so it must be set correctly.

To verify that the variable is set correctly, execute the command

	echo $INSIGHT
  • it should be set to the Insure installation directory
  • if the end is "/bin.sun4" (or similar for different platforms) it is set incorrectly
  • when you execute the command "ls $INSIGHT", the output should look like:
		-> ls $INSIGHT
		bin.sun4/    examples/      help/       include/	
		lib.sun4     man/           src.sun4/
(with the appropriate platform name(s), of course)

If you cannot get it set correctly, unset it completely by executing the command

unsetenv INSIGHT
